Bert: If negotiations are sincere, the tariff level on August 1st will be temporary.
US Treasury Secretary Steven Mnuchin said in an interview with CNBC that the "snapback tariffs" rate that took effect on August 1 will continue for "a few days to a few weeks, as long as countries continue to make progress and negotiate in good faith." Regarding the tariff rates that took effect on August 1, Mnuchin said, "I don't think this is the end of the world." Mnuchin also said that President Trump is satisfied with tariff revenue in some cases, even more than reaching agreements themselves.
